Evolution of Editing Technologies

Transition from Analog to Digital Editing

  • Early film editing involved manually cutting and splicing together strips of film using tools like film splicers and editing tables
  • Linear video editing systems (U-matic and Betamax) introduced in the 1970s allowed editors to work with video tape, improving efficiency and flexibility
  • (NLE) systems emerged in the late 1980s and early 1990s revolutionized the editing process by allowing editors to access and manipulate any part of the footage at any time without physical splicing
  • Digital video formats and computer-based NLE software (, , ) in the 1990s and 2000s further enhanced the speed, precision, and creative possibilities of editing

Impact of Technology on Editing

Increased Efficiency and Creative Focus

  • The transition from analog to significantly reduced time and effort required for physical manipulation of footage
  • Allows editors to focus more on creative decision-making
  • Non-linear editing systems provide greater flexibility and control over the editing process
  • Enables experimentation with different cuts, transitions, and sequences without risking damage to original footage

Integration of Visual Effects and Compositing

  • Digital visual effects and compositing tools within NLE software blur the lines between editing and post-production
  • Empowers editors to create more visually compelling and seamless sequences
  • Advanced color correction and grading tools allow editors greater control over the visual aesthetics of a film, enhancing emotional impact and narrative depth

Challenges and Opportunities in Editing

Keeping Up with Technological Change

  • The rapid pace of technological change in the editing industry can be challenging for editors
  • Requires continuous learning and adaptation to new software, workflows, and best practices
  • The increasing complexity of editing software and abundance of features and tools can lead to a steeper learning curve for aspiring editors
  • Emphasizes the importance of proper training and education

Balancing Technical Requirements and Creative Vision

  • The growing demand for high-resolution, high-fidelity content has increased storage and computational requirements for editing systems
  • Necessitates significant investments in hardware and infrastructure
  • solutions present opportunities for greater collaboration and flexibility but raise concerns about data security, reliability, and the need for stable high-speed internet connections
  • The democratization of editing tools and proliferation of user-generated content have intensified competition within the industry
  • Challenges professional editors to differentiate themselves through their unique skills, creativity, and storytelling abilities
